The Role

The Manager of Finch’s Developer Success Engineering (DSE) team is a critical leadership role responsible for scaling Finch's technical post-sales function. You will lead, coach, and develop a team of high-performing DSEs, owning the operational rigor required to ensure predictable technical health. You will ensure our team drives product adoption, and accelerates growth across our customer portfolio. You will act as the critical point of escalation for Developers that work with Finch, and serve as a strategic partner to Engineering and Product leadership regarding customer-facing technical challenges & opportunities.


What You Will Do
  • Strategic Leadership & Team Growth: Recruit, hire, coach, and manage a high-performing Developer Success Engineering (DSE) team. Own performance development, capacity planning, and ensure team alignment with financial targets.
  • Process & Operational Scaling: Own the continuous evolution of the DSE function, building scalable workflows, processes, and tools to maximize team efficiency and impact.
  • Technical Escalation Ownership: Serve as the final point of contact for complex technical escalations, leading incident post-mortems and ensuring swift, effective resolution for high-priority customer blockers.
  • Product Advocacy & Strategy: Oversee the team’s mechanism for providing prioritized, systemic product feedback to Engineering and Product leadership, driving core product roadmap decisions.
  • Growth Enablement: Collaborate with Account Management (AM) leadership to convert technical health insights into actionable growth strategies, ensuring DSEs effectively identify and surface expansion signals.
  • Data Rigor & Health: Establish processes to systematically capture and measure the technical health of the customer base, translating those metrics into required EPD resources and strategic investments.
  • Ecosystem Navigation: Lead the team in improving customer experience by developing architectural strategies to simplify the ways developers work with Finch across diverse API maturity levels.


Who You Are
  • Proven Technical Management: You possess 3+ years of experience managing, leading, and developing a customer-facing technical team (Solutions Architects, Technical CSMs, etc.).
  • Deep Technical Credibility: You have deep expertise in API architectures, advanced client-resolution methodologies, and cloud environments (AWS a bonus).
  • Strategic Cross-Functional Leader: You have a proven ability to drive complex cross-functional alignment and accountability across Engineering, Product, and Sales organizations.
  • Executive Communication: You possess exceptional communication skills, capable of credibly troubleshooting complex technical issues while translating technical concepts into clear business implications for executive stakeholders.
  • Industry & Product Mindset: Experience in a B2B SaaS environment, ideally with exposure to payroll integrations, employee benefits ecosystem, and/or HR system architecture.
  • Growth & Problem-Solving: You demonstrate a genuine curiosity for technology and thrive in environments requiring you to navigate complex product challenges and scaling growing pains effectively.
